A Boone County judge has scheduled a September 27 jury trial for a man accused of kidnapping, assaulting and raping his ex-girlfriend in Columbia in 2019. 35-year-old Raymond Charles Williams of Jefferson City is charged with eight felonies, including kidnapping, rape and sodomy. A trial date has not been set for a Columbia man charged with strangling his wife to death and then putting her body in an apartment dumpster on Amelia. 40-year-old Keith Comfort appeared briefly Tuesday in Boone County Circuit Court, via video. Boone County judge interested in trial readiness in high-profile Columbia murder case
A Boone County judge is expected to ask attorneys Tuesday afternoon in a high-profile Columbia murder case where they are on trial readiness. 40-year-old Keith Comfort is charged with second degree murder for the death of his wife, Megan Shultz. Columbia’s Fotoohighiam slams criminal justice system, following acquittal
A Columbia businessman who’s been acquitted on charges of trying to have his ex-wife killed describes the legal system as corrupt. Judge Steven Ohmer found Mehrdad Fotoohighiam not guilty, following this week’s bench trial at the Boone County Courthouse.
